#[derive(Debug, thiserror::Error)]
#[non_exhaustive]
pub enum BhavaError {
#[error("unknown trait: {name}")]
UnknownTrait { name: String },
#[error("unknown trait level '{level}' for trait '{trait_name}'")]
UnknownTraitLevel { trait_name: String, level: String },
#[error("mood dimension out of range: {dimension} = {value} (must be -1.0..=1.0)")]
MoodOutOfRange { dimension: String, value: f32 },
#[error("unknown archetype layer: {name}")]
UnknownLayer { name: String },
#[error("unknown preset: {id}")]
UnknownPreset { id: String },
#[error("invalid personality config: {reason}")]
InvalidConfig { reason: String },
#[error("decay rate must be positive: {rate}")]
InvalidDecayRate { rate: f32 },
#[cfg(feature = "ai")]
#[error("network error: {0}")]
Network(#[from] reqwest::Error),
#[error("storage error: {0}")]
Storage(String),
}
pub type Result<T> = std::result::Result<T, BhavaError>;
